Kaltohmfeld
Kaltohmfeld is a village in Leinefelde-Worbis, Eichsfeld, Thuringia. Kaltohmfeld is situated nearby to the hamlet Neubleicherode, as well as near the village Kirchohmfeld.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Birkenberg
Peak
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Birkenberg, at 533.4 m above sea level, is the highest point in the Ohm Hills. It is located in the county Eichsfeld, northern Thuringia, Germany.
